Implantation: A "fertilized egg" may not implant, and 14 days after ovulation, a menstrual period will occur. "Implanted" fertilized eggs will not have a menstrual period occur, but if implanted in an area outside the uterine wall (ectopic pregnancy), bleeding will occur which may appear to be a "period", but if a serum HCG is positive, see your OBGYN provider immediately.
